Days 11 & 12: Still taking it easy at home, yet he finds a way to get all the attention and praise!!
** UPDATE: this morning he followed Phil into the kitchen and WITHOUT PROMPT hit the “outside” button!! **

Days 9 & 10: Jax has been a touch under the weather so we have been taking it easy with the buttons. But he’s been working hard to know that different buttons mean different rewards!! (He is getting banzos off-camera which makes him very exicted!)
Day 8 : Teaching Jackson multiple buttons...
Today we trained with his “scritches” button and placing “banzo” right next to it. He picked up quickly!!
We also have a “permanent” place for his two living room buttons. We are keeping “scritches” and added “love you” after this video was taken ♥️ he will get a kiss and hug when he presses his new button!
Day 7 : Jackson is asking for “scritches” without us holding the button or even pointing toward it! We can tell he is so proud 👑
Now to consider finding a permanent place for the button to live... we have been placing the button in front of him for him to learn. Almost time!!

Day 6 : I do believe it has *clicked* !!
Heading back to “scritches” today, Jackson sure seems to grasp the concept of button = reward. Woo hoo!!
Note: right after this, he pressed his “how do” button at the back door telling us he wanted outside. Smart boy!!
Day 5 : Doing a little something extra, to see if he merely does it for treats {banzos!}, will he grasp the button concept quicker?
Answer: meh, about the same.
Back to “scritches” and “outside” only, until he gets it!
Day 4 : Still training for “scritches” ... he can be super lazy about it, but we think he’s starting to get it.
Day 3 : This is so fun watching Jackson take in the is concept little by little... he will “how do” the outside button on command now - just a matter of time until he does it on his own.
That said, we added a new button: “scritches”
The new button lives in the family room and we began this training today. Added trainer treats for a little added incentive. He did very well and we trained for about 45 minutes!
Day 2 : Jackson is making great progress with both Phil and myself. We only do button training when he indicates that he wants to actually go out; no instigating.
He will “how do” with the button in our hands, and we praise him & let him out when he touches/presses the button completely.
Trying to keep consistent so he can continue to pick up quickly!

Day 1 : We started pressing the button every time we went outside {button is right by the back door} and telling Jackson that he can “how do” the button for outside.
His evening’s progress in the video!
Day 0 : Introducing Jackson to his “outside” button
Greetings! I’m Jackson’s mom, Lucy.
I’ve created this blog to keep track of our husky’s daily/weekly progress in AAC {augmentative & alternative communication}.
Thanks for following and rooting for our boy as he learns this new method of communicating with us...
Jackson Snow
... is a 4(ish) year old husky(ish) mix. He came into our lives October 2019 and has always been an excellent communicator. After being inspired by Alexis Devine and Christina Hunger, we decided to gift Jackson (and ourselves) with a few recordable buttons to see if he would eventually pick up on this unique and exciting skill!
